Output 7e51eec4ff496aa422e4e0ce2ddebd687ecf7bb7db17b7a788dd413e53dc5424:19

value
2572034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 412ea846520e53cd27362d3db6aa35f9eb87a2bd OP_EQUAL
address
37dfjpXxxaUR7hn12UnJvVN7zTg3LKRZZM
transaction
7e51eec4ff496aa422e4e0ce2ddebd687ecf7bb7db17b7a788dd413e53dc5424
spent
true